Yuri Gusev: VTB Bank (Armenia) is going to become a banking retail leader by 2014
ArmInfo. VTB Bank (Armenia) is going to become a banking retail leader by 2014, Yuri Gusev, Director General, Chairman of the Directorate of VTB Bank (Armenia), told ArmInfo.
"We have been demonstrating the highest growth rates of our portfolios and customer base for nearly three years. This year we have become bank No.1 in the card business and gained the second position in provision of personal loans. I think the only major goal of our bank may be to become the leader in this market", he said.
As regards the demand for retail services in the regions, he stressed that the most demanded services there are conversion, transfers and lending, particularly, lombard loans and other kinds of consumer loans. Gusev added that almost the whole range of services is launched in the VTB branches in large towns.
Gusev said that the most efficient branches in retail are the central branches in Yerevan and the large regional branches in Gyumri, Vanadzor and Meghri. "Moreover, the branch in Meghri is one of our best branches, which regularly demonstrates serious results", he stressed.
To note, VTB Bank (Armenia) has the largest branch network in the country - 69 branches (44 in the regions and 25 in Yerevan). The Bank issues and serves Visa cards and serves the local ArCa cards. As of 1 October 2012, the number of active cards of the Bank was 200 thsd (1st position).
